Description:
|
Github plugin 1.9.1
In "Manage Jenkins/Configure System" I have chosen the option "Let Jenkins auto-manage hook URLs" with a username and Oauth token (verification ok). Afterwards I setup in my build job to "Build when a change is pushed to GitHub". The service is added in Github under "Webhooks & Services". Whenever a change is pushed the build job is triggered: nice. But when I just go to "Manage Jenkins/Configure System" and hit the save button (without making any change) the service is being removed in Github under "Webhooks & Services" !?
